1. Babyletto Hudson 3-in-1 Crib

Many parents are interested in the various choices available for a crib. Many want their crib to adapt to their child, and a few of the best rated cribs offer frames that can be converted into a toddler bed and daybed.

The Babyletto Hudson 3 in 1 Crib is an excellent illustration of this. It has a beautiful design that can be a perfect match for any style of nursery. The crib is constructed of eco-friendly New Zealand Pine wood and has sleek round spindles. It comes in a range of finishes including a modern gray, a white and crisp or a classic white/espresso two-tone.

The crib is designed to be in compliance with or exceed all U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ission and Juvenile Products Manufacturers Association standards. This includes stringent manufacturing specifications and safety testing. For instance, the slats are spaced 2" apart, as opposed to the standard maximum of 2 3/8" and are treated with non-toxic multi-step coating processes that are free of lead, phthalates and other harmful elements.

It's larger than cribs we have tested and will require more square footage in your space than a few of the smaller minimalist options however its dimensions make it a great option for a large new nursery or when you want a grand classic design. The manufacturer provides touch-up paint pen for covering scratches and other cosmetic flaws. It also uses Greenguard certification for the quality of finish and emissions.

The Hudson is one of the few cribs to come with the required parts to convert it into the daybed or toddler bed. Adding the toddler rail is simple and the crib will be safe for your growing child when it is converted to a toddler bed.

Baby sleeps for around 16 hours a day, so it's crucial to ensure that their sleep environment is secure. A properly assembled, maintained, and used crib can reduce the risk of sudden infant death syndrome (SIDS) and suffocation and entrapment. To prevent gaps or crevices that could trap a baby crib, cribs should be equipped with slats that are no more than 2.4 inches apart.

Cribs are designed to adapt as your child grows. Having a crib with different mattress support levels is a fantastic feature. This lets you lower the mattress level as your child grows older and prevents him from climbing out of the crib.
